The Hive platform can help develop apps faster,
effectively increase app users,
and promote user engagement.

Developers can quickly implement authentication, promotions, billing, etc. through the Hive SDK, reducing development costs, and all features can be operated and managed from the Hive console.

New Features

  • NEW

    Chat service equipped with AI chat filtering

    The newly launched Hive chat automatically detects and blocks prohibited words and advertising messages through AI chat filtering, in addition to real-time chat, group chat, and 1:1 chat. Apply the chat API and provide a pleasant chat environment.

    Learn more
  • NEW

    Web store that increases sales

    Now customers can purchase products anytime from the online store. You can open the online store independently or operate both a community and an online store on one web. Register product information in the Hive console and start selling.

    Learn more
  • NEW

    Remote Play for Gaming

    You can set up a service environment with just a simple plugin integration. The host's PC screen is automatically hidden for security, and dedicated websites are provided for each app. Experience high-performance game streaming services at Hive.

    Learn more

Getting Started with Hive Platform

Is this your first time with the Hive platform?
Go through the onboarding process to apply Hive services to your game.
After onboarding, by installing the Hive SDK, you can add various features such as login,
billing, ad banners, push messages, etc. or call APIs in your app.

Requirements

This is a necessary step to use the Hive platform.

Step Description Shortcut
1. Console Sign Up Sign up for the console and log in.
2. Create a New Project After logging into the console, click the new project button. Enter the project code and company code to create the project. Project Management
3. Register App In the App Center - AppID Management, proceed to create a new AppID. Create AppIDs for each market you will serve. AppID Management

Connect Game and Market

Please follow the steps below to log in to the game, make payments, and use push notifications.

Step Description Shortcut
1. Set Authentication Key Check the authentication key for the login method to be used in each market and register it in the Hive console. Set Login IdP
2. Set Store Key Check the payment key information to be used in each market and register it in the Hive console. Set Billing Key by Store
3. Set Push Certificate Check the APNs and GCM keys in the market for sending push notifications from the app and register them in the Hive console. Set Push Certificate

Main Guide for Development and Operations

Check the flow of the Hive platform running in the app first.

Development Guide

  • SDK Installation

    SDK Installation Guide
    This includes the process of downloading and installing the Hive SDK.
    Product Feature Installation
    This explains the process of installing product features of the Hive SDK for each engine.
    Configuration
    Define the settings required for SDK execution during app operation.
    Market-Specific Settings
    This provides guidance on settings required by the SDK depending on the market.
  • Product Development

    Login
    Implement automatic login, implicit login, and explicit login.
    In-App and PG Payments
    Quickly implement a billing system for product inquiries and purchase verification, including PG payment integration.
    App Push
    Check the development guide to enable push notifications through the Hive console.
    Display Interstitial Banners
    Apply promotional features to encourage more user
    engagement.
    Ad Monetization
    Easily apply the Admob advertising module through Hive Adiz.
    Marketing Attribution
    Supports Adjust, Singular, AppsFlyer, Firebase, and Airbridge.
    PC Games
    Launch PC games through the PC SDK and crossplay launcher.
    Web 3 Games
    Launch Web 3 games with just API calls without the need to develop complex blockchain functionalities.
    Abuse Detection
    Hercules provides a safe and pleasant gaming environment through game abuse detection and tracking features.
    Leaderboard
    Easily implement a ranking system and enhance user engagement and satisfaction.
    Match Making
    Quickly implement PVP match matching in games using the API.
  • App Services

    Information Collected by Hive
    This describes the information collected by Hive services. Use it when submitting your app to the market.
    Platform and App Integration Check
    Check if the app and the Hive platform are well integrated through the checklist.

Console Guide

  • Product Settings

    Register Terms
    Expose terms and privacy policy in the app to protect rights and comply with regulations.
    Register Items
    Register in-game currency and items to manage game operations such as promotions and customer service.
    Register Market PID
    Register in-app products in the console for receipt verification and monitoring.
    Promotion Settings
    Check essential processes to use promotional features such as campaign banners and cross-promotion.
    Admob Settings
    Adiz is an ad monetization service that supports Admob, allowing easy integration of Admob.
    Create Community
    Users can use the community with their game accounts.
    Web 3 Game Settings
    Set up blockchain features necessary for the development and operation of Web 3 games.
  • Live Operations

    Update and Maintenance Popups
    Manage popups for maintenance or updates to be displayed when entering the game based on AppID and server.
    Usage Suspension
    Register, lift, and check the history of suspensions for user accounts.
    Device Management
    A service for managing user devices to prevent account theft.
    Issue Coupons
    Issue and manage unique, bulk, and regular coupons available for online and offline channels.
    Register Event Campaigns
    Expose various banner types suitable for event purposes in the game.
    Register Push Campaigns
    Send large-scale, targeted pushes based on time zones to allow more users to enter the game.
    Register Leaderboard
    Create a leaderboard by selecting the ranking reset cycle, operation period, and ranking sorting method.
    Register Matches
    Set conditions for various types of PVP match opponents according to the purpose of gameplay.
  • Data Analysis

    Log Definition
    If you need additional logs beyond the default provided logs, try creating a new table and defining the logs.
    Segment
    Classify users by setting conditions and conduct targeted campaigns with segment snapshots.
    Funnel
    Analyze at which stage new users are dropping off.
    Retention
    Check when and which type of users have a high revisit rate over a specific period.
    Game Indicators
    Provides metrics on users, play status, revenue, advertising status, and campaigns for
    the game.
    Comprehensive Indicators
    You can view detailed metrics such as concurrent users, real-time, daily, monthly key indicators, and advertising metrics.
    Custom Indicators
    In addition to the metrics provided by default, you can create custom indicators using the collected logs.

Download the latest SDK
and get started with development!